1 collection of 11 analoog camera whit 2 lichtmeter


1-Ricoh Camera AF-77 Panorama 35mm Film Point And Shoot Camera Working W/Case - The AF-77 is a point-and-shoot camera for 35mm film, introduced by Japanese manufacturer Ricoh in 1993-Tested and working
2-Agfamatic 200 Sensor Camera - Vintage German 126 Film Camera with Case - The Agfamatic 200 Sensor is a simple camera for 126 cartridge film introduced by Agfa in 1972-Tested and working
3-Ricoh FF-20 wide zoom | Panorama zoom 32-64mm macro with Case - Vintage from the 1990s - Materials: Metal, Glass, Electronics, plastic-Tested and working
4-Minolta Zoom 160c-37.5 -160mm f/5.4 lens with Case - The Zoom 160c was released around 2002–2003-Tested and working-Attention!!!The film holder can no longer be closed, as the locking mechanism is broken.
5- FUJIFILM FOTONEX 400IX ZOOM MRC APS CAMERA WITH CASE 4X ZOOM with Case - Super-EBC Fujinon Zoom 25–100 mm lens. 1990s-Tested and working
6-Olympus mju 1, analoge compactcamera - The Olympus μ[mju:] 1 — an analog compact camera — was first released in 1991.Tested and working
7-Vivitar 35 EF with Case - The Vivitar 35 EF is a compact 35mm viewfinder camera from 1970s-Tested and working
8-Nikon Zoom 100 AF - The Nikon Zoom 100 AF was manufactured and first released in the mid-1990s, around 1994.Tested and working
9-Samsung AF Zoom 800 with Case - A simple, fully automatic point-and-shoot 35mm film camera from the 1990s.Tested and working
